Output a23b6626f032d3fa981be340beb331eac0f6bb2b44265ea4592800e4e8ad67eb:2

value
17648884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4b26e1fcb26745f8997829998414db74b68eea3 OP_EQUAL
address
3Kd47gsYHGWCoHsVD9pk1ShWPxwdbBGnEC
transaction
a23b6626f032d3fa981be340beb331eac0f6bb2b44265ea4592800e4e8ad67eb
confirmations
258270
spent
true